'Raagdesh' trailer to be launched in Parliament

     Written by : IANS | Thu, Jun 22, 2017, 06:31 PM

New Delhi, June 22: The trailer launch of the upcoming film 'Raagdesh' will be taking place at Parliament here.

The film's director Tigmanshu Dhulia says it is to honor the heroes of the Independence struggle.

"To launch the trailer of 'Raagdesh' in the Parliament honors the heroes of the Independence struggle. It is the first time that Parliament has allowed a trailer launch and that in itself is a big honor for our film," Dhulia said in a statement.

'Raagdesh' is the story of the famous Red Fort trial of the Three INA officers that changed the course of India's freedom movement.

Talking about the film, Dhulia said: "The Red Fort trial is one of the most interesting and relevant parts of our Independence history. And 'Raagdesh' is about that fascinating case."

The film's cast includes Kunal Kapoor, Amit Sadh and Mohit Marwah. It is presented by Rajya Sabha TV and produced by Gurdeep Singh Sappal.

'Raagdesh' is slated to release on July 28.
